Aryna Sabalenka’s Dream Week at Indian Wells 2026: Engagement, New Puppy, Title — ‘I’ll Remember This Forever’ | Watch Video

Aryna Sabalenka wins Indian Wells 2026 after a thrilling final against Elena Rybakina, capping an unforgettable week that included her engagement, a new puppy, and her 10th WTA Masters 1000 title.

WTA World No. 1 Aryna Sabalenka had not just one of the best weeks on court, but also a memorable one off it, a week she says she will “definitely remember for the rest of her life.” The Belarusian tennis star admitted this during her victory speech at Indian Wells 2026, where she lifted her first trophy at the tournament on March 15 at the Tennis Paradise.

Sabalenka faced long-time rival Elena Rybakina in the final, and after a thrilling two-and-a-half-hour battle, she emerged victorious 3–6, 6–3, 7–6 (8–6), With this win the four-time Grand Slam winner claimed her 10th WTA Masters 1000 title, joining an elite group that includes Serena Williams and Iga Swiatek.

After the win, Sabalenka, who got engaged on March 4 to her longtime boyfriend Georgios Frangulis, proudly showed off her engagement ring again, something fans have loved seeing in recent days. During the speech, she gave a sweet shoutout, saying, “And… thanks my fiancé.”

She then summed up her incredible week by saying, “What a week. Getting a puppy. Getting engaged. Winning a title. I’ll definitely remember it for the rest of my life.”

Aryna Sabalenka’s New Puppy

Last week, Sabalenka introduced fans to her new dog, Ash. She shared pictures with the puppy on Instagram and wrote, “Team Tiger has a new addition. Everyone meet Ash.”

Since the arrival of Ash in her life Sabalenka’s mental health has improved. She admitted that Ash has been providing her emotional and mental support.

“I feel like I’m much more settled, calm, more in control,” she said to Tennis Channel. “Whenever I feel like going crazy on my team, I just pet Ash and I feel better.”

After winning the title at Indian Wells on Sunday battling a tough Kazakh opponent and the searing heat of California, Sabalenka, celebrated it with her dog. She then, jokingly dipped her head into an ice cooler and also put her dog in it for a moment, giving him ice bath.

Having previously lost finals at the Tennis Paradise in 2023 and 2025, Sabalenka finally broke the “curse” to win her 23rd career title. 

So far in the 2026 season, Sabalenka has looked strong in defending her World No. 1 ranking. She reached the Australian Open final and has already won titles at the Brisbane Open and Indian Wells.
